Question:
I talked with sales but what is the best way to mount RM-501 on my 2008 Jeep Wrangler JK with a Sunpie Jeep Wrangler Front Bumper with Winch Plate for JK. The bumper is certainly capable since it includes a 12K lbs wrench. Problem is accessing the frame because of the skid plate. Here is a link to the bumper I am referencing, and I will post a picture of it and the tow bar in question. Would it be safe if I were to install the Tow Bar Quick Disconnect Brackets circled in the pix indirectly on the bumper frame via 2x2x3/8inch metal framing or is there a mount kit one can use or recommendations? Please call if possible and leave a call back number if you get VM. Thank you,
asked by: Mauricio S
Expert Reply:
Hey Mauricio, I checked out your Sunpie front bumper and it has D-rings on the front of it that would be your best option for attaching a tow bar too. So for that you'd need the D-ring adapter part # RM-035-1 which would attach directly to them. You would need to use a tow bar that stores on the motorhome though like the Falcon 2 part # RM-520. The RM-501 would not work with this adapter.
